版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
2026年IT行业招聘考试技术基础+编程知识题库一、单选题(共10题,每题2分)1.题目:在Java中,以下哪个关键字用于声明一个类是抽象的?A.finalB.abstractC.staticD.public2.题目:Linux系统中,用于查看当前目录下文件和文件夹权限的命令是?A.dirB.ls-lC.chmodD.pwd3.题目:在Python中,用于删除字典中指定键的语句是?A.deldict[key]B.removedict[key]C.popdict[key]D.deletedict[key]4.题目:SQL中,用于检索不重复数据的关键字是?A.DISTINCTB.UNIQUEC.NULLD.ANY5.题目:HTTP协议中,表示“页面未找到”的状态码是?A.200B.404C.500D.3026.题目:在C++中,用于动态分配内存的运算符是?A.malloc()B.newC.free()D.delete7.题目:Git中,用于将本地修改提交到仓库的命令是?A.gitpushB.gitcommitC.gitpullD.gitclone8.题目:在JavaScript中,以下哪个方法用于将JSON字符串转换为对象?A.JSON.parse()B.JSON.stringify()C.JSON.convert()D.JSON.toObject()9.题目:TCP/IP协议栈中,传输层的主要协议是?A.HTTPB.FTPC.TCPD.UDP10.题目:在Docker中,用于启动容器的命令是?A.dockerrunB.dockerstartC.dockerbuildD.dockerps二、多选题(共5题,每题3分)1.题目:以下哪些是Java中的基本数据类型?A.intB.StringC.doubleD.booleanE.float2.题目:Linux系统中,以下哪些命令用于文件压缩?A.tarB.gzipC.zipD.compressE.rsync3.题目:Python中,以下哪些方法可以用于列表排序?A.sort()B.sorted()C.arrange()D.reverse()E.bubble_sort()4.题目:SQL中,以下哪些函数属于聚合函数?A.COUNTB.SUMC.AVGD.MAXE.MIN5.题目:在网络安全中,以下哪些属于常见的攻击方式?A.DDoSB.SQL注入C.XSSD.APTE.ARP欺骗三、判断题(共5题,每题2分)1.题目:在JavaScript中,`==`和`===`的区别是,前者会进行类型转换,后者不会。(正确/错误)2.题目:Linux系统中,`sudo`命令用于以超级用户权限执行命令。(正确/错误)3.题目:在Python中,字典是无序的,但在Python3.7及以上版本中,字典保持插入顺序。(正确/错误)4.题目:SQL中,`INNERJOIN`和`LEFTJOIN`的区别是,前者只返回两个表都匹配的记录,后者返回左表所有记录及右表匹配的记录。(正确/错误)5.题目:在Docker中,`docker-compose`用于定义和运行多容器Docker应用。(正确/错误)四、简答题(共5题,每题4分)1.题目:简述TCP的三次握手过程及其意义。2.题目:简述Git中`branch`和`merge`命令的用途及区别。3.题目:简述HTTP和HTTPS的区别。4.题目:简述Python中列表和元组的区别。5.题目:简述SQL中`GROUPBY`语句的用途。五、编程题(共3题,每题10分)1.题目:用Python编写一个函数,接收一个列表,返回列表中所有偶数的平方。2.题目:用Java编写一个方法,接收一个整数,判断其是否为素数,如果是返回`true`,否则返回`false`。3.题目:用SQL编写一个查询,从`employees`表(包含`id`,`name`,`department`,`salary`字段)中检索每个部门的平均薪资,并按平均薪资降序排列。答案与解析一、单选题1.答案:B解析:Java中`abstract`关键字用于声明抽象类,抽象类不能直接实例化,必须被继承。`final`用于声明不可修改的变量或方法;`static`用于声明静态成员;`public`是访问修饰符。2.答案:B解析:`ls-l`命令用于以长格式显示文件和文件夹权限、所有者、大小等信息。`dir`是Windows命令;`chmod`用于修改权限;`pwd`显示当前目录路径。3.答案:A解析:`deldict[key]`用于删除字典中的键值对。`pop`需要返回值;`remove`用于列表;`delete`不是Python标准语法。4.答案:A解析:`DISTINCT`关键字用于去除查询结果中的重复行。`UNIQUE`是数据库约束;`NULL`表示空值;`ANY`是SQL中的比较运算符。5.答案:B解析:404表示“页面未找到”,200表示成功,500表示服务器错误,302表示重定向。6.答案:B解析:`new`运算符用于动态分配内存。`malloc()`是C语言中的函数;`free()`用于释放内存;`delete`用于C++中释放内存。7.答案:B解析:`gitcommit`用于将本地修改提交到仓库,`gitpush`用于上传到远程仓库,`gitpull`用于下载数据,`gitclone`用于创建本地副本。8.答案:A解析:`JSON.parse()`将JSON字符串转换为JavaScript对象,`JSON.stringify()`反之,`JSON.convert()`和`JSON.toObject()`不是标准方法。9.答案:C解析:传输层主要协议是TCP(可靠传输)和UDP(不可靠传输),HTTP是应用层协议,FTP是文件传输协议。10.答案:A解析:`dockerrun`用于创建并启动容器,`dockerstart`用于启动已停止的容器,`dockerbuild`用于构建镜像,`dockerps`用于查看容器。二、多选题1.答案:A,C,D,E解析:Java基本数据类型包括`int`,`double`,`boolean`,`float`,`char`,`String`是对象类型。2.答案:A,B,C,D解析:`tar`,`gzip`,`zip`,`compress`都是常用的压缩命令,`rsync`用于文件同步。3.答案:A,B解析:`sort()`用于原地修改列表,`sorted()`返回新列表,`reverse()`用于反转列表,`bubble_sort()`是算法,不是Python内置方法。4.答案:A,B,C,D,E解析:`COUNT`,`SUM`,`AVG`,`MAX`,`MIN`都是SQL聚合函数。5.答案:A,B,C,D,E解析:DDoS、SQL注入、XSS、APT、ARP欺骗都是常见的网络攻击方式。三、判断题1.答案:正确解析:`==`会进行类型转换,`===`不会,这是JavaScript中的严格比较。2.答案:正确解析:`sudo`允许用户以超级用户权限执行命令。3.答案:正确解析:Python3.7及以上版本中,字典保持插入顺序。4.答案:正确解析:`INNERJOIN`返回两个表匹配的记录,`LEFTJOIN`返回左表所有记录及右表匹配的记录。5.答案:正确解析:`docker-compose`用于定义和运行多容器Docker应用。四、简答题1.答案:TCP三次握手过程:1.客户端发送SYN包(序列号seq=x)给服务器,进入`SYN_SENT`状态。2.服务器回复SYN+ACK包(序列号seq=y,确认号ack=x+1)给客户端,进入`SYN_RCVD`状态。3.客户端发送ACK包(序列号seq=x+1,确认号ack=y+1)给服务器,进入`ESTABLISHED`状态,服务器也进入`ESTABLISHED`状态。意义:确保双方都准备好通信,防止已失效的连接请求干扰。2.答案:`branch`:用于创建新的分支,允许并行开发。`merge`:用于将一个分支的变更合并到另一个分支。区别:`branch`是创建分支,`merge`是合并分支。3.答案:-HTTPS是HTTP的安全版本,通过SSL/TLS加密传输数据。-HTTP传输数据未加密,HTTPS加密传输。-HTTPS需要证书,HTTP不需要。-HTTPS端口为443,HTTP为80。4.答案:-列表是可变序列,元组是不可变序列。-列表可以用`[]`创建,元组用`()`创建。-列表支持修改,元组不支持。-列表占用内存比元组大。5.答案:`GROUPBY`语句用于将查询结果按指定列分组,常与聚合函数(如`SUM`,`AVG`)一起使用,以分析分组数据。五、编程题1.Python代码:pythondefeven_square(lst):return[x2forxinlstifx%2==0]2.Java代码:javapublicbooleanisPrime(intnum){if(num<=1)returnfalse;for(inti=2;i<=Mat
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 水族造景工创新应用考核试卷含答案
- 养鸡工岗前岗位知识考核试卷含答案
- 栓剂工创新方法测试考核试卷含答案
- 办公耗材再制造工安全防护模拟考核试卷含答案
- 铁氧体材料制备工岗前理论综合考核试卷含答案
- 锻件切边工风险评估竞赛考核试卷含答案
- 酒店员工培训与岗位胜任力评估制度
- 酒店客房预订系统操作规范制度
- 酒店餐饮服务与食品安全管理体系制度
- 车站客运服务规章管理制度
- 八年级地理上册《中国的气候》探究式教学设计
- 离婚协议书(2026简易标准版)
- 重庆市2026年高一(上)期末联合检测(康德卷)化学+答案
- 2026年湖南郴州市百福控股集团有限公司招聘9人备考考试题库及答案解析
- 2026贵州黔东南州公安局面向社会招聘警务辅助人员37人考试备考题库及答案解析
- 2026年数字化管理专家认证题库200道及完整答案(全优)
- 铁路除草作业方案范本
- 2026届江苏省常州市生物高一第一学期期末检测试题含解析
- 2026年及未来5年市场数据中国高温工业热泵行业市场运行态势与投资战略咨询报告
- 教培机构排课制度规范
- 2026年检视问题清单与整改措施(2篇)
评论
0/150
提交评论